heater core "vent"?

i assusme there is a vent that opens and closes when you turn the **** from cold to hot. my **** is broken. but i would like to have heat and i know my heater core is not clogged. does this flap/vent exist? if so where is it and how hard is it to get to it?

if there is a section in the fsm or other pdf file please let me know.

I believe there's a motor that controls the blend door, not sure on the FD but on the FC Mazda called it the "air mix motor". It's up in there somewhere, haven't had to get to it.
